Specifications

  • Product: Tap Connector Snap On Male - 3/4" BSPF Brass
  • Inlet: ¾” BSP Female
  • Outlet: Snap-On Male Quick Connector
  • Colour: Gold
  • Material: Brass
  • Available pack sizes: 1, 25, 200

  • Weight per unit: 25 grams

Description

The Tap Connector Snap On Male - 3/4" BSPF Brass is a robust and reliable accessory designed for seamless integration with your garden hose system. Crafted from high-quality brass, this connector offers exceptional durability and resistance to wear and tear, ensuring long-lasting performance even under demanding conditions. The brass construction also provides excellent corrosion resistance, making it ideal for outdoor use where exposure to water and weather is common.

Featuring a snap-on click lock quick connector end, this tap connector allows for effortless attachment and detachment of hoses and fittings. The innovative snap-on mechanism ensures a secure and leak-free connection with just a simple push, saving you valuable time and effort. This user-friendly design not only enhances convenience but also minimizes the risk of accidental disconnections during use.

The connector is equipped with a 3/4” BSP female thread, making it compatible with standard 3/4” BSP male threaded hoses and fittings. This universal thread size ensures easy integration with a wide range of gardening tools and equipment, providing flexibility and versatility for all your watering needs.
